# Android中的Fork进程 在Android开发中,进程是非常重要的概念。而fork进程是实现多进程编程的一种常用方式。在本文中,我们将介绍Android中的fork进程的基本概念、用法以及示例代码。 ## 什么是fork进程? 在Android中,fork进程是指通过复制父进程来创建子进程的操作。子进程将会拥有与父进程相同的内存映像、文件描述符、环境变量等属性。通过fork进程,我
原创 2024-06-07 05:16:52
33阅读
目录1.写在前面2.直接联系用户方式2.1通过Github用户信息2.2通过提交代码是配置的邮箱信息2.3通过向作者的仓库提交issue2.4通过作者曾经提交的issue进行回复3.通过官方途径进行维权3.1私人删除部分内容和文件3.2删除整个仓库4.总结1.写在前面作为开发者,我们都比较了解Github,有时兴致冲冲的将项目放到Github上维护起来,还期待获得几个star,不经意可能将敏感数据
    进程(Process)是计算机中的程序关于某数据集合上的一次运行活动,是系统进行资源分配和调度的基本单位,是操作系统结构的基础。fork    fork创建的新进程被称为子进程(child process),fork函数被调用一次,返回两次,子进程的返回值是0代表成功,而父进程的返回值则是子进程的进程 id。    子进
转载 2024-07-14 17:40:30
26阅读
Git-LFSGit LFS:(Large File Storage)把音乐、图片、视频等指定的任意文件存在 Git 仓库之外,而在 Git 仓库中用一个占用空间 1KB 不到的文本指针来代替文件的存在,通过把大文件存储在 Git 仓库之外,可以减小 Git 仓库本身的体积,使克隆 Git 仓库的速度加快,也使得 Git 不会因为仓库中充满大文件而损失性能;核心思想:把需要进行版本管理、但又占用很
Linux和Unix操作系统都是以C语言编写的,这使得它们非常灵活和可定制。其中,Linux操作系统的一个重要组成部分就是内核,而内核中的一个关键功能就是进程管理,这涵盖了进程的创建、销毁、调度等。在Linux内核中,有一个非常重要的概念叫做"fork"(分支),它使得一个进程能够创建出一个完全一模一样的子进程。 通过fork,父进程可以在子进程上运行一个全新的程序,这使得进程之间的通信和协作变
原创 2024-04-26 09:21:15
92阅读
# 什么是 Android Fock? 在 Android 开发中,我们经常会听到 "Fork" 这个词。那么,什么是 Android Fock 呢? Fork,即分叉,是指通过复制一个现有的仓库(repository)来创建一个新的仓库。在 Android 开发中,Fork 通常用于以下两种情况: 1. **贡献开源项目**:当你想为一个开源项目做出贡献时,你可以先 Fork 该项目的仓库
原创 2023-07-15 03:01:32
189阅读
1、flock最大的用途就是实现对 crontab 任务的串行化;为了防止crontab 任务出现多实例的情况,导致系统内存被耗尽。在 crontab 任务中,有可能出现某个任务的执行时间超过了 crontab 中为此任务设定的执行周期,这就导致了当前的任务实例还未执行完成,crontab 又启动了同一任务的另外一个实例这通常不是用户所期望的行为。极端情况下,如果某个任务执行异常一直未返回,cro
1、设计四个类,分别是:(知识点:抽象类及抽象方法)(1)Shape表示图形类,有面积属性area、周长属性per,颜色属性color,有两个构造方法(一个是默认的、一个是为颜色赋值的),还有3个抽象方法,分别是:getArea计算面积、getPer计算周长、showAll输出所有信息,还有一个求颜色的方法getColor。(2)2个子类:1)Rectangle表示矩形类,增加两个属性,Width
转载 2023-08-18 16:45:33
51阅读
 队列介绍进程彼此之间互相隔离,要实现进程间通信(IPC),multiprocessing模块支持两种形式:队列和管道,这两种方式都是使用消息传递的 创建队列的类(底层就是以管道和锁定的方式实现)制定队列最大大小Queue([maxsize]):创建共享的进程队列,Queue是多进程安全的队列,可以使用Queue实现多进程之间的数据传递。参数介绍:maxsize是队列中允许最大
转载 2023-06-26 16:08:04
85阅读
Android系统一共分为5层:    Application(系统应用)    FrameWork(Java API 框架)    Native Libraries(原生 C/C++ 库 )+Android Runtime(ART虚拟机+Core Libraries[Andro
转载 2023-08-29 20:58:10
54阅读
excel中的合并计算功能经常被忽视,其实它具备非常强大的合并功能,包括求和、平均值、计数、最大值、最小值等一系列合并计算功能。下面小编教你在excel中怎么使用合并计算,希望对你有帮助!↓↓↓更多的excel怎么做表格的资讯(详情入口↓↓↓)excel合并计算的方法以三个库的库存表为例,每个仓库库存型号和数量都不一样,其中其中有重合,现在我们怎么才能计算出汇总库存量出来。首先在这三张库存表后新建
知识点: 脚本可以传参数进去,就和 c/c++ 的代码可以传给 main 函数参数一样。 Calvin Johnson 和他以前的学生慢慢写出来的 Projected Hartree Fock 程序,Hartree Fock 的部分叫做 Sherpa,意思是夏尔巴人,是攀登珠穆朗玛峰的引路人(我就知 ...
转载 2021-09-24 15:22:00
110阅读
2评论
fock 的意思是复制进程, 就是把当前的程序再加载一次, 不同之处在,加载后,所有的状态和当前进程是一样的(包括变量)。 fock 不象线程需提供一个函数做为入口, fock后,新进程的入口就在 fock的下一条语句。 一个现存进程调用f o r k函数是U N I X内核创建一个新进程的唯一方法(这并不适用于前节提及的交换进程、i n i t进程和页精灵进程。这些进程是由内核作为自举过程
转载 精选 2011-03-10 11:13:24
6207阅读
redis真的是单线程吗?首先我们得厘清一个事实,我们说的Redis单线程,其实指的是redis的网络IO和键值对是由一个线程执行,这是redis对外提供键值存储服务的主要流程。此外,还有持久化、异步删除、主从复制数据同步等都是主线程fock出的子线程来执行的。但是fock子线程,主线程也是会阻塞的,实例越大,fock阻塞的时间就会越长。所以严格来说,Redis并不是单线程来完成所有操作的。red
转载 2024-05-29 20:30:51
28阅读
简介从上一篇文章Zygote进程浅析我们知道Zygote是孵化器,所有其他Dalvik虚拟机进程都是通过zygote孵化(fock)出来的;所以SystemServer进程是由Zygote进程fock(孵化)出来的。SystemServer进程是Android系统的核心之一,大部分Android提供的服务都在该进程中,SystemServer中运行的进程总共有六十多种,主要包括:ActivityM
前言从上一篇文章Zygote进程浅析我们知道Zygote是孵化器,所有其他Dalvik虚拟机进程都是通过zygote孵化(fock)出来的;所以SystemServer进程是由Zygote进程fock(孵化)出来的。SystemServer进程是Android系统的核心之一,大部分Android提供的服务都在该进程中,SystemServer中运行的进程公共有六十多种,主要包括:ActivityM
转载 2024-04-16 20:15:38
39阅读
1、查找dom元素.但它并不支持jquery语法。 $$("#fock"); // 目前仅仅知道可以查找Dom元素 2、查找dom元素绑定的事件。 getEventListeners(document.getElementById("type")) 3、绑定并且监听元素的事件 monitorEven
转载 2017-02-21 15:06:00
157阅读
2评论
     紧接上一篇zygote进程的启动流程,上一篇的结尾提到zygote进程中会fock出一个system_server进程,用于启动和管理Android系统中大部分的系统服务,本篇就来分析system_server进程是如何创建并运行的以及它都做了哪些重要的工作。//文件路径:frameworks\base\core\java\com\android\inter
转载 2023-10-19 16:10:24
34阅读
文章目录​​面试系列文章​​​​进程和线程的区别、开销​​​​fock 相关问题​​​​进程间通信​​​​管道pipe​​​​命名管道FIFO​​​​消息队列MessageQueue​​​​共享内存SharedMemory​​​​信号量Semaphore​​​​信号 ( sinal )​​​​socket套接字通信​​​​线程池​​​​线程池七大参数​​​​线程池任务提交流程​​​​内存管理、虚拟
原创 2022-01-02 10:53:06
210阅读
文章目录父进程自己调用fock()来创建一个或多个子进程的进程,所有的进程只有一个父进程2.子进程被创建的进程子进程所有的资源都继承父进程,但是两个不共享地址,继而变量也不会共享...
原创 2022-01-24 16:22:29
499阅读
  • 1
  • 2
  • 3
  • 4
  • 5